Peoples Bancorp of North Carolina Inc is a bank holding company. It is a state-chartered commercial bank serving Lincolnton, Newton, Denver, Catawba, Conover, Maiden, Claremont, Hiddenite, Hickory, Charlotte, Cornelius, Raleigh and Cary, North Carolina. It has a diversified loan portfolio with no foreign loans and few agricultural loans. The company's main source of income is dividends declared and paid by the Bank on its capital stock.
Keros Therapeutics Inc is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on the discovery, development, and commercialization of novel treatments for patients suffering from hematological, pulmonary, and cardiovascular disorders with high unmet medical needs. The company's protein therapeutic product candidate, KER-050, is being developed for the treatment of low blood cells counts, or cytopenias, including anemia and thrombocytopenia, in patients with myelodysplastic syndromes, or MDS, and in patients with myelofibrosis.
